L&T bags 1,320-MW power project order in Bihar New Delhi: Infrastructure company, Larsen & Toubro (L&T), on Monday said its power arm procured a mega engineering, procurement and construction order from SJVN Thermal to set up a 1,320-MW (megawatt) ultra-supercritical power plant in Bihar’s Buxar district.

SJVN Thermal is a wholly-owned subsidiary of SJVN, a joint-venture of Government of India and Government of Himachal Pradesh and also a Mini Ratna public sector undertaking.

“With a majority of the equipment including boilers, turbines, generators, etc, being made locally in our manufacturing facilities at Hazira, this project will also go a long way in accomplishing the ‘Make in India’ initiative promoted by our Prime Minister,” said Shailendra Roy, chief executive officer and managing director, L&T Power, and whole-time director of L&T.

The scope of work for L&T includes design, engineering, manufacturing, procurement, supply, construction, erection, testing, and commissioning of Buxar Thermal Power Project on turnkey basis.

The foundation stone of the plant was laid by Prime Minister Narendra Modi in March this year.
